Vapor barrier installation services involve the application of a specialized membrane designed to prevent moisture from passing through floors, walls, or ceilings. These barriers are typically installed in areas prone to dampness, such as basements, crawl spaces, and underneath concrete slabs. The process usually includes preparing the surface, laying out the vapor barrier material, and sealing all edges and seams to ensure an effective moisture barrier. Proper installation helps maintain a dry environment and can contribute to the longevity of building materials by preventing water-related damage.

One of the primary issues vapor barriers address is excess moisture that can lead to mold growth, wood rot, and structural deterioration. In spaces where humidity levels fluctuate or where groundwater seepage is common, moisture can accumulate unnoticed, causing damage over time. Installing a vapor barrier helps control this unwanted moisture, reducing the risk of mold proliferation and improving indoor air quality. It also helps prevent the deterioration of insulation and other building components, which can compromise the energy efficiency and safety of a property.

Vapor barrier installation is frequently sought for residential, commercial, and industrial properties alike. Homes with basements or crawl spaces often require vapor barriers to protect against basement flooding or high humidity levels. Commercial buildings, especially those with storage or manufacturing facilities, benefit from vapor barriers to maintain controlled environments and prevent moisture-related issues. Additionally, new construction projects often incorporate vapor barriers during the building process to ensure long-term durability and to meet building codes related to moisture control.

Material Costs - The cost of vapor barrier materials typically ranges from $0.25 to $0.75 per square foot, depending on the type and quality selected. For a standard basement, material expenses can vary from $100 to $500. Local contractors can provide specific estimates based on project size and material choices.

Labor Expenses - Installation labor rates generally fall between $0.50 and $1.50 per square foot. For an average-sized space, total labor costs might range from $200 to $1,000. Costs may fluctuate based on project complexity and regional rates.

Project Size Impact - Larger areas, such as expansive basements or crawl spaces, tend to increase overall costs proportionally. For example, a 1,000-square-foot installation could cost between $500 and $2,500 overall, including materials and labor. Local pros can assess specific project requirements for accurate pricing.

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include surface preparation, insulation, or repair work, which can add several hundred dollars to the total. These expenses depend on existing conditions and specific installation needs. Contact local service providers for detailed cost assessments.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a vapor barrier used for? A vapor barrier helps prevent moisture from passing through floors, walls, or ceilings, protecting structures from water damage and mold growth.

Where are vapor barriers typically installed? Vapor barriers are commonly installed in basements, crawl spaces, and underneath concrete slabs to control moisture levels.

How long does vapor barrier installation usually take? The installation duration depends on the area size and complexity but generally ranges from a few hours to a full day.

Can vapor barriers be installed in existing structures? Yes, vapor barriers can be added to existing spaces, often during renovations or moisture remediation projects.

What types of materials are used for vapor barriers? Common materials include polyethylene plastic sheeting, foil-backed membranes, and other moisture-resistant materials suitable for different applications.
